I was going to mention Audiokinesis as a manufacturer that uses beryllium compression drivers. I have them in my Audiokinesis Zephrins. They are excellent. 

My local audio pals who have listened to my system can’t get over how smooth they are especially with horned instruments that typically can be bright as all get out with a compression driver.
